Biography of Ramoji Rao:

Ramoji Rao, also known as Cherukuri Ramoji Rao, is an Indian businessman, media entrepreneur, and the founder of Ramoji Group, one of the largest media conglomerates in India. Here's a brief biography:

Early Life of Ramoji Rao:

Ramoji Rao was born on November 16, 1936, in Pedaparupudi, a small village in the West Godavari district of Andhra Pradesh, India.
He began his career as a journalist and worked for the Telugu daily newspaper Eenadu.

Founding Eenadu:

In 1974, Ramoji Rao launched the Telugu-language daily newspaper "Eenadu." It quickly became popular for its investigative journalism and objective reporting.
Under Ramoji Rao's leadership, Eenadu played a crucial role in shaping public opinion in Andhra Pradesh.

Ramoji Rao's Expansion into Media and Entertainment:

Ramoji Rao expanded his media empire by venturing into television. In 1995, he launched ETV (Eenadu Television), a network of regional language channels, which includes Telugu, Kannada, Marathi, and others.
Ramoji Film City, one of the largest film studio complexes in the world, was inaugurated by him in 1996 near Hyderabad. It has since become a major hub for the Indian film industry.
Ushakiran Movies, a film production company, is also a part of the Ramoji Group.

Honors and Awards to Ramoji Rao:

Ramoji Rao has received numerous awards and honors for his contributions to journalism, media, and business.
In 2016, he was honored with the Padma Vibhushan, the second-highest civilian award in India.

Philanthropy:

Apart from his success in the media and entertainment industry, Ramoji Rao has been involved in various philanthropic activities.
He established the Priyadarshini Academy in 1980 to promote academic excellence and support economically underprivileged students.

Legacy of Ramoji Rao:

Ramoji Rao is widely regarded as a pioneering figure in Indian journalism and media. His contributions to the industry have left a lasting impact, and the Ramoji Group continues to be a major player in the media and entertainment sector.

Ramoji Rao's journey from a small village to the helm of a media conglomerate showcases his entrepreneurial spirit and commitment to quality journalism and entertainment.
